PURPOSE OF THE JOB
The Quality Engineer demonstrates teamwork and commitment to the success of Owens Corning. The Quality Engineer is a recognized leader that demonstrates Owens Corning’s values and a commitment to high performance. The Quality Engineer plans, strategizes and evaluates quality assurance process through examining the systems, measures and statistical techniques. S/he will participate in creating and analyzing operations and restrictions regarding services. Individual will participate in auditing, generating and executing training on quality assurance concepts and equipment. Quality Engineer will collaborate with other engineering business-partners within the Owens Corning organization, along with customers and suppliers. S/he will inspect quality equipment and recommend improvements.
